Your Ideal Fly Fishing Line
Choosing the suitable fly fishing line can massively impact your success on the water. It's not just about presentation, but also about matching the line to your equipment and the style of fish you're targeting. A properly selected line will effortlessly deliver your flies, allowing for optimal presentation and boosting your chances of a hookset.
To help you navigate the territory of fly fishing lines, here's a comprehensive guide to choosing the perfect line for your needs.
- Think about Your Fishing Pole: The weight and length of your rod will influence the appropriate line weight.
- Understand Line Types: There are multiple types of fly fishing lines, each with its own traits.
- Research Different Weights: Line weights are measured in numbers and align to the rod's weight rating.
By following these suggestions, you can confidently choose a fly fishing line that will enhance your angling experience.
